ANEW Realty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at ANEW Realty in the United States is $82,243.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$40. Salaries at ANEW Realty typically range from $72,282 to $93,052 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Indianapolis?

Understanding the cost of living near Indianapolis is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at ANEW Realty.
Indianapolis' Cost of Living Index is approximately 83.5 (16.5% less expensive than US average; 7.8% less than IN average). State capital, affordable housing, growing downtown. IndyGo b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from ANEW Realty,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$950 - $1,400+ A significant portion of ANEW Realty sal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$140 - $230 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$60 (IndyGo mon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$380 - $560 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$350 - $650+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$360 - $670+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,240 - $3,510+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
